Problems solved by technology

[0002] In the past, electric kettles generally used plastics with a certain elastic deformation capacity to make the kettle body of the electric kettle. The disadvantages of the electric kettle are the variability after heating and the short life of the kettle body. Currently, the remaining kettle bodies made of hard materials such as ceramics and glass The electric kettle is equipped with a heating plate at the bottom port of the kettle body, and the heating plate is socketed with the inside of the kettle. The highest surface of the heating plate is lower than the bottom surface of the cup body; In case of direct contact, when the glass electric kettle is in a dry state, the heating plate is in direct contact with the glass body, and the local temperature of the glass body is high, causing the cup body to burst and break, resulting in casualties and product damage

Embodiment

[0018] refer to Figure 1-2 , this embodiment proposes an anti-dry boiling glass kettle, comprising a kettle body 1, the bottom of the kettle body 1 is provided with an annular connecting wall, and the annular connecting wall is a trumpet-shaped structure, and the periphery of the kettle body 1 is provided with a sealing recess. groove, and the sealing groove is located at the end of the ring-shaped connecting wall, the bottom of the pot body 1 is provided with a heating plate 2, the periphery of the heating plate 2 is provided with a side wall, and the edge of the side wall is provided with an annular groove. The wall is located in the annular groove, and the side wall is fixed in the sealing groove, the annular connecting wall and the side wall form a sealing structure, and the top of the heating plate 2 and the sealing structure form a water storage tank, the water storage tank is connected with the sealing structure, and the storage The sink is filled with water 3;

Abstract

The invention discloses an anti-dry boiling glass kettle, which comprises a kettle body, the bottom of the kettle body is provided with an annular connecting wall, and the annular connecting wall is a horn-shaped structure, and the periphery of the kettle body is provided with a sealing groove , and the sealing groove is located at the end of the annular connecting wall, the bottom of the pot body is provided with a heating plate, the periphery of the heating plate is provided with a side wall, and the edge of the side wall is provided with an annular groove, so The annular connecting wall is located in the annular groove, and the side wall is fixed in the sealing groove, and the annular connecting wall and the side wall form a sealing structure. The invention utilizes the fluidity of water and good heat-absorbing performance to ensure that the local temperature will not be too high during the dry burning process of the kettle body, causing the phenomenon of bursting and damage of the kettle body. Reduce the loss rate, improve the labor efficiency, greatly improve the user's safety, and also reduce the cost increase caused by the damage and rupture of the glass jug body during production.
